0
It's a great Walmart property in Mexico but great service and employee friendly and helpful
Cool
Great
Dr
Haha there are a lot of people but everything is cool with the video game offers :)
0
It's a great Walmart property in Mexico but great service and employee friendly and helpful
a year ago0
Cool
a year ago0
Great
2 years ago0
Dr
2 years ago0
Haha there are a lot of people but everything is cool with the video game offers :)
a week ago